Sweet sweet Georgia. After wrapping up my trip in Turkey, I thought nothing could top that experience.. and now there's Georgia, a relatively unknown country among travelers and that was enough of a reason for me to go there. I crossed the border from Kars, Turkey to Tbilisi and immediately made a few friends at the hostel. We hung out, cooked for each other, checked out the nightlife scene and explored the capital city of Georgia together. It was like a little family we formed.

During that night out in Tbilisi, we met Sophie in an open air concert we accidentally stumbled upon. She was a very friendly local who invited us to join her in the quest of finding the real night life of Tbilisi. It was so random yet very rewarding. People are much more friendlier here than in Egypt, Jordan or even Turkey.

After Tbilisi, we went to Kazbegi and did a bunch of day hikes around the area. Kazbegi is beyond words. It was like a scene from the movie, the Sound of Music. Lush green fields, colorful flowers, and mountainous landscape. It was truly a hidden gem in this area and I highly recommend to give Georgia a go.

Beautiful mountain, charming people, and best of all, the cheap food. I hope this video will convey these messages. Enjoy!
